Gingerbread Coffee: Your Cozy Cup of Holiday Joy

Enjoy a warm and festive Gingerbread Coffee, perfect for cozy mornings and holiday gatherings.
Prep Time 10 minutes
Cook Time 5 minutes
Total Time 15 minutes
Servings: 2 cups
Course: Breakfast
Cuisine: American
Calories: 250

Ingredients
  

For the Coffee Base
  • 12 ounces Medium or Dark Roast Coffee Quality beans for bold flavor
For the Gingerbread Syrup
  • 2 tablespoons Gingerbread Syrup Store-bought or homemade
For the Creamy Texture
  • 1 cup Milk Frothed; whole or dairy alternatives
For the Topping
  • 1 cup Whipped Cream Optional indulgent addition
  • 1 dash Cinnamon For garnish and flavor enhancement
For a Festive Touch
  • 1 piece Gingerbread Cookie To serve alongside

Equipment

  • Coffee Maker
  • Saucepan
  • frother

Method
 

Step‑by‑Step Instructions for Gingerbread Coffee
  1. Start by brewing your medium or dark roast coffee using your preferred method. Measure out about 12 ounces of water and let it steep for 4–5 minutes.
  2. While the coffee brews, warm milk in a saucepan over medium heat, stirring constantly until steam appears (about 3–4 minutes). Froth until foamy.
  3. In a mug, add 2 tablespoons of gingerbread syrup. Pour the brewed coffee over it, stirring gently.
  4. Carefully pour the frothed milk over the coffee mixture, creating a layered effect. Stir gently if desired.
  5. Top with whipped cream for indulgence and sprinkle with cinnamon.
  6. Serve immediately alongside a gingerbread cookie.
